如果我向localhost:8080/..
发出请求,则得到的是Tomcat错误页面,而不是使用Spring配置的预期的Whitelabel错误页面。
我的自定义ErrorController
并未在对..
的请求中记录任何内容,这表明Spring根本没有处理这些错误。
我已经通过请求不存在的URL(例如localhost:8080/not-defined
)来测试我的错误处理配置,并且得到了预期的Whitelabel错误页面。此外,我的ErrorController
符合预期。
我们要避免公开底层Web服务器的详细信息。在这种情况下,有什么方法可以禁用/替代Tomcat服务器错误处理?